Verizon's Cybersafe Philly program will hold its next free cybersafety summit at Cherry Hill High School East in Cherry Hill with special guest, Tina Meier, one of the nation's most sought-after speakers on the topics of cyberbullying and cybersafety. Tragically, Meier's daughter, Megan, took her life in 2006 at age 13 after becoming victim to a cyberbullying attack orchestrated by an adult and teenager who lived down the street from her family. With the danger of cyberbullying and online predators facing area children daily, Verizon has pledged to educate parents and students across the Greater Philadelphia Region about the importance of proactive and preventative measures to ensure the safe and effective use of technology. This is the fifth of 10 planned Cybersafe Philly summits across southeastern Pennsylvania, New Jersey and Delaware. All summits will be free and open to all parents in the community.
